There is currently no official training programme for physicians wishing to become specialists in Obstetric Medicine. However, this may change in the future as there is consideration by PMETB and the Department of Health to make Obstetric Medicine a speciality.
Currently, the Kings Fund, a charitable organisation with the aim of improving healthcare services, is conducting a year-long review into the safety of maternity services. A statement from the RCP is available here which supports the training and input of specialist obstetric physicians into maternity services.
